Asphalt roof inspection services involve a thorough assessment of an existing roof's condition to identify potential issues before they develop into more significant problems. These inspections typically include checking for visible signs of damage, such as cracked or missing shingles, as well as examining the roof’s overall structure, flashing, and drainage systems. The goal is to detect early signs of wear, leaks, or deterioration that could compromise the roof’s integrity. Regular inspections help property owners maintain the roof’s lifespan and prevent costly repairs by addressing issues promptly.

One of the primary benefits of asphalt roof inspections is their ability to uncover problems that may not be immediately visible or obvious. For example, small cracks or areas of shingle granule loss can indicate underlying damage that could lead to leaks or structural issues if left unaddressed. Inspections also help identify areas vulnerable to water infiltration, which can cause interior damage and mold growth. By catching these issues early, property owners can plan necessary repairs or maintenance, extending the roof’s durability and avoiding unexpected expenses.

The overview below groups typical Asphalt Roof Inspection proj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Harford County, MD.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Inspection Costs - Typical costs for an asphalt roof inspection range from $150 to $300, depending on the size and complexity of the roof. Larger or more complex roofs may cost more, with prices reaching up to $500 in some cases.

Service Fees - Many service providers charge a flat fee for asphalt roof inspections, often around $200 to $400. Additional costs may apply if repairs or detailed assessments are needed afterward.

Additional Expenses - If a detailed report or drone inspection is requested, costs can increase to approximately $300 to $600. These services provide more comprehensive assessments but come at a higher price point.

Cost Variations - Prices for asphalt roof inspections vary based on location, roof size, and inspection scope. In Harford County, MD and nearby areas, typical costs fall within the ranges mentioned, but exact quotes depend on local providers.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are signs that an asphalt roof needs an inspection? Indicators include missing or damaged shingles, visible cracks, granule loss, or signs of water leaks inside the building.

How often should asphalt roofs be inspected? It is recommended to have asphalt roofs inspected at least once a year or after severe weather events.

What does an asphalt roof inspection typically involve? Inspections generally include checking for damaged or missing shingles, inspecting flashing and vents, and assessing overall roof condition.

Can a roof inspection identify potential issues before they become serious? Yes, inspections can reveal early signs of damage or deterioration that may require maintenance or repairs.
